Yesterday we told you about the odd-and-“absolutely-not-paid-for” A9 reference on last week’s “The O.C.”

Now searchenginewatch.com reports that Ask Jeeves was tossed about on last week’s “Arrested Development” by none other than Henry Winkler (Ed. – The Fonz!), playing the lawyer for the increasingly delusional Bluth family. What’s next, Wisenut on “Desperate Housewives”?

However, unlike A9 execs, who swear they didn’t know of or pay for the name drop, an Ask Jeeves exec has a connection with “Arrested Development” – but also says swears no cash changed hands. This must be some bizarre L.A. barter system.
